Description: Bridgepixing the abandoned, Historic Queen Creek Bridge, on the north side of Hwy 60, which is now carried by the "New" (1952) Queen Creek Bridge, a modern steel arch bridge. This concrete arch bridge is listed on the National Register of Historic Places. We have more than 13,000 images of other Bridges and a Bridge Blog at www.Bridgepix.com.
